The offence is aimed, first, at articles that are designed solely for
fraud, such as credit - card cloning devices, or ATM fascia for skimming bank details; the police had complained that
when they found such devices at a person's home address there was no obvious offence to
charge, despite the plain ill - intent.
According to the fundamental idea of property, indeed, nothing ought to be treated as such, which has been acquired by force or
fraud, or appropriated in ignorance of a prior title vested in some other person; but it is necessary to the security of rightful possessors, that they should not be molested by
charges of wrongful acquisition,
when by the lapse of time witnesses must have perished or been lost sight of, and the real character of the transaction can no longer be cleared up.
